Good news, even if it's a lie

Leave it to People Magazine to soften the blow for Lindsay Lohan. The thoroughgoing boobs at the magazine’s website suggest her latest bomb, “I Know Who Killed Me,” “strongly divided the nation's movie critics,” while only being able to dredge up one favorable review amidst a plethora of pans.

In fact, the scorecard at rottentomatoes.com suggests the exact opposite – critics were united in a way they rarely are in excoriating what one review called a “sleazy, inept and worthless piece of torture porn.”

We must really be getting weak when the media not only has to filter coverage of the burning issues of the day, but a gossip rag has to sugar coat our celebrity news.
